Unhappy Wind Sensor Awning WARNING!!!

This is my heartbreaking NEWBIE mistake with my 2018 AI !!

Be very mindful when leaving the curb side rear door fully opened and held by the magnet on the curb side of AI, especially when your awning is extended.

If the wind sensor activates the retraction cycle, it is not able to fully retract because the rear door in tall enough to catch the awning's metal cover.

If you are nearby and quick enough when that happens you may be lucky enough to stop the awning before it hits the door. However, if you are not nearby (as I was), the awning will jam against the back door. My damage appears minor but probably needs looking at by Airstream techs.

The awning will also hit the top of the side sliding door when open if not adjusted properly. I made two support poles from adjustable length brush handles and pull fuse #10 on the side of the drivers seat base. This will remove power from the awning and steps but stop the aggravation of the awing retracting in the slightest breeze.
